On Friday night, the Jammu & Kashmir administration asked tourists and Amarnath Yatris to leave the State in view of the prevailing security situation. It's reported that intelligence operatives believe there are going to be terror attacks in the coming days.

This comes just days after 28,000 paramilitary troops were deployed to the State. About 35,000 troops, who were meant to man the Amarnath Yatra routes, have been disengaged from that duty. They will now be deployed for other security purposes in the State.

The developments have created panic. Says Suhasini Haidar, Governments must reassure, not spread panic with notifications for tourists to leave the State. The toll this kind of callous messaging takes on ordinary people is unconscionable.
